HTTPS部署在流量分配模型中的增长逻辑

真绝了~使用Wireshark工具抓取https数据明文包

使用Wireshark工具抓取HTTPS数据明文包的方法在网络安全分析过程中,有时需要抓取并分析HTTPS流量的明文数据。虽然Wireshark默认无法直接显示HTTPS的明文内容,但通过设置SSLKEYLOGFILE环境变量,可以使得Chrome或Firefox浏览器在访问HTTPS网站时,将对应的密钥保存到本地文件中。随后,Wireshark可以利用这个日志文件对HTTPS报文进行解密。以下是详细的操作步骤:一、环境准备操作系统:Windows 10 专业版Wireshark版本:v4.0.8-0-g81696bb74857(或其他支持TLS密钥日志功能的版本)二、设置SSLKEYLOGFILE环境变量打开系统属性:右键点击“我的电脑”,选择“属性”。在弹出的窗口中,点击左侧的“高级系统设置”。或者,在运行(Win+R)中输入“systempropertiesadvanced”,按回车打开。添加环境变量:在“系统属性”窗口中,点击“高级”选项卡下的“环境变量”按钮。在“系统变量”区域,点击“新建”按钮。变量名输入SSLKEYLOGFILE,变量值设置为你想保存密钥日志文件的路径,例如F:sslsslkey.log。注意:此路径可自行配置,但设置完后需要重启浏览器才会生效。三、修改Wireshark配置启动Wireshark:打开Wireshark软件。设置TLS密钥日志文件路径:在Wireshark的菜单栏中,点击“编辑”(Edit)。选择“首选项”(Preferences)。在弹出的窗口中,展开左侧的“Protocols”列表,选择“TLS”。在“(Pre)-Master-Secret log filename”字段中,输入之前设置的SSLKEYLOGFILE环境变量的路径,例如F:sslsslkey.log。点击“确定”保存设置。四、查看HTTPS抓包明文数据重新抓包:在Wireshark中,选择一个网络接口开始抓包。访问HTTPS接口:使用设置了SSLKEYLOGFILE环境变量的浏览器访问一个HTTPS网站或接口。查看明文数据:在Wireshark的抓包结果中,找到对应的HTTPS流量。此时,你应该能够看到HTTPS流量的明文数据,包括请求头、响应头等详细信息。五、结语通过以上步骤,你可以成功使用Wireshark抓取并查看HTTPS流量的明文数据。这种方法在网络安全分析、调试和开发过程中非常有用。但请注意,这种方法涉及到对HTTPS流量的解密,可能涉及到隐私和法律问题,请务必在合法和合规的范围内使用。


nginx